The sensors connect via a bluetooth connection. It should be pairable from within the app on other android version. For Graphene OS I have found I need to pair via the OS bluetooth settings for the app to see them. This is as simple as pair new device, add pin, done they show up in app.
For the private space it does not appear to recognize the sensor paired via phone wide setting and pairing with the app just does an endless "searching for sensor". I will note that I have a garmin bluetooth paired in this same method within the same private space so I don't believe it's a limitation of the private space and bluetooth.
I have remove the app and pairings completely from owner and user accounts before trying in the private space. Unless I am misunderstanding, the Private Space shares BT settings from the owner space - or at least I can not see a way to specifically pair within the private space.
